LEGISLATIVE BUDGET BOARD Austin, Texas FISCAL NOTE, 83RD LEGISLATIVE REGULAR SESSION April 19, 2013 TO: Honorable Geanie Morrison, Chair, House Committee on Elections FROM: Ursula Parks, Director, Legislative Budget Board IN RE:HB3065 by Menéndez (Relating to payment of funds by the secretary of state for the cost of primary elections), As Introduced No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ated. The bill would amend the Election Code to require the Secretary of State (SOS) to pay funds requested by a political party involved in a primary election to the county in which the primary elections were held. SOS indicated that any costs associated with the bill could be absorbed within the agency's existing resources. Local Government Impact No f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.
